There’s a hidden supply battle
DUSK has a long emission schedule: the network emits 500M DUSK over 36 years, with emissions halving every four years. �

At the same time, staking locks DUSK and helps secure the network.
That creates an interesting balance.
Staking can reduce liquid supply.
But staking rewards also add new supply.
So saying “more staked = automatically bullish” is too simple.
What I’d really watch is:
staked DUSK vs new emissions vs actual network demand.
That’s the supply-demand battle I think matters.
